It is a boutique hotel, a small number are associated with no view and spaciousness. But the location is great, the center, which is everywhere. Near the main shopping street Hoofstrat all good shops on it. The hotel is very clean, new, in-room Nespresso coffee machine, coffee lover, and so that shoppers will love this place) PS parking is expensive.

It's the second time that I have booked this hotel. It's a great find. Small and comfortable with great beds, jacuzzi style baths and air con in a quiet street The staff are friendly. Thomas Is particularly caring. It's not a big hotel with fancy service but a small quality fun Place with a self service bar.

Official Description (provided by the hotel):
Hotel JL No76 is located in two 18th-century mansions in the heart of Amsterdam, right in the middle of the museum & fashion district. Leidseplein, Vondelpark, Concert Hall and its two sister hotels, Hotel Vondel and Hotel Roemer are a stone’s throw away. Hotel JL No76 has 39 luxurious rooms, a lounge, honesty bar, restaurant and a private inner garden. The honesty bar allows guests to make or serve a drink or bite at any convenient time. The hotel is decorated in boutique style with the use of high quality materials and has a large collection of art on display. Barbara Broekman, a well-known Dutch artist, has designed a special range of wallpaper for each of the 39 rooms. This wallpaper is based on details enlargement of originally embroidered artworks. The rooms are decorated in 5 ambiances and are equipped with modern facilities like free use of iPad, wireless internet, iPod dock station, Nespresso coffee machine, Flat Screen TV, DVD player and DVD library. All executive rooms have a Jacuzzi with built-in TVs. The comfortable COCO-MAT beds in all rooms ensure a relaxing stay. ... more   less
